PicardQt is a new version of PicardTagger, written using Qt as the GUI toolkit. It also includes implementations of a few new ideas, such as IntuitivePicardInterface or TaggerScript.

Development Source Code

The source code is maintained in a Bazaar branch at http://bazaar.launchpad.net/~luks/picard/qt-port. To download it you need to install Bazaar and run:

bzr branch http://bazaar.launchpad.net/~luks/picard/qt-port picard-qt

If you already have the branch and want to update it, use:

bzr pull
  • Ubuntu Feisty: To get the right bazaar version, install package bzr, not bazaar. To build picard-qt from the source, you need to:
    • sudo apt-get install g++ python-dev libexpat-dev python-qt4 python-mutagen
    For all optional features (I think), add: sudo apt-get install libavformat-dev libofa0-dev libgstreamer0.10-dev gstreamer0.10-ffmpeg (This is from my experience, feel free to add anything else you notice. --Bogdanb)

Installation From Source Code

To run Picard you need at least:

Optionally also:

Once you have installed the requirements, you can compile the C extensions:

python setup.py config
<edit build.cfg if neccessary>
python setup.py build_ext -i

And now you can start Picard:

python tagger.py

Mac OS X Installation Notes

A rough installation guide is available here: /MacInstallGuide

The Apple supplied python 2.3 in OSX 10.4.x will not work with picard, and some of the dependencies listed above expect a framework version of python. http://pythonmac.org/packages/ provides a framework python 2.4 which seems to work.

Changes

Version 0.9.0alpha9 - 2007-05-12

  • New Features:
    • The tag editor now accepts free-text tag names.
    • Load 'DJ-mixed by' AR data to %djmixer% tag.
    • Load 'Mixed by' AR data to %mixer% tag.
    • Delay the webservice client to do max. 1 request per second.
    • Sort files in clusters by disc number, track number and file name. (2547)
    • Support for any text frame in special variable %_id3:%.
    • Ignore empty ID3 text values.
    • Windows installer:
      • Removed DirectX-based decoder.
      • FFmpeg compiled with AAC (faad2) support.
  • Bug Fixes:
    • Save XSOP frame to ID3v2.3 tags. (2484)
    • Use attributes like 'guest' or 'additional' also from generic performer ARs.
    • Fixed capitalization of %releasetype% in file naming preview. (2762)
    • Fixed 'python setup.py build_ext' if py2app and setuptools are loaded.
    • ID3v2.3 frame TDAT should be written in format DDMM, not MMDD. (2770)
    • Don't display an error on Ogg and FLAC files with no tags.
    • Remove video files from the list of supported formats.
    • Always use musicbrainz.org for PUID submissions. (2764)
    • Files/Pending Files count not reset/recalculated after removing files. (2541)
    • Removed files still get processed during fingerprinting. (2738)
    • Read only text values from APEv2 tags. (2828)

Version 0.9.0alpha8 - 2007-04-15

  • New Features:
    • Notification of changed files in releases. (2632, 2702)
  • Bux Fixes:
    • Don't open the file for analyzing twice. (2733, 2734)
    • Save ASIN and release country to ID3 tags. (2484, 2456)
    • Variable %country% renamed to %releasecountry%.
    • Save release country to MP4 and WMA tags.
    • Don't take unsupported tags into account when checking if the tags are 'complete' and the file should have 100% match. This fixes problems with showing the green check-marks for file with limited tag formats, like MP4 or WMA.
    • Ignore missing tag in $unset().

Version 0.9.0alpha7 - 2007-04-14

  • New Features
    • Remember location in the file browser. (2618)
    • Added FFmpeg support on Windows (MP3, Vorbis, FLAC, WavPack and many other audio formats).
    • Lowercase the extension on file renaming/moving. (2701)
    • TaggerScript function $copy(new,old) to copy metadata from variable old to new. The difference between $set(new,%old%) is that $copy(new,old) copies multi-value variables without flattening them.
    • Added special purpose TaggerScript variable %_id3:% for direct setting of ID3 frames. Currently it supports only TXXX frames in format %_id3:TXXX:<description>%, for example: $copy(_id3:TXXX:PERFORMERSORTORDER,artistsort).
    • Support for WAV files. (2537)
    • Removed GStreamer-based decoder.
    • Implemented python setup.py install_locales.
  • Bug Fixes:
    • Failed PUID submission deactivates the submit button. (2673)
    • Unable to specify album art file name mask. (2655)
    • Fixed incorrect copying of album metadata to tracks. (2698)
    • Added options to un-hide toolbars. (2631)
    • Fixed problem with saving extra performer FLAC tags containing non-ASCII characters. (2719)
    • Read only the first date from ID3v2.3 tags. (2460)
    • If the remembered directory for add dialogs and file browser was removed, try to find an existing directory in the same path.

Version 0.9.0alpha6 - 2007-04-04

  • New Features:
    • Added option --disable-autoupdate for 'build' and 'install' commands of the setup script. (2551)
    • Automatically parse track numbers from file names like 01.flac for better cluster->album matching with untagged files.
    • Support for the new sorting tags in MP4 tags from iTunes 7.1.
    • Strip white-space from directory names. (2558)
    • When replacing characters with their ascii equivalent, 'ß' should be replaced by 'ss'. (2610)
    • Track level performer ARs. (2561)
    • Remove leading and trailing whitespace from tags on file saving. (892, 2665)
    • Support for labels, catalog numbers and barcodes.
  • Bug Fixes:
    • Artist names from ARs should be translated, too.
    • Freeze after answering no to "download the new version" prompt. (2542)
    • %musicbrainz_albumid% not working in file renaming. (2543)
    • Track time appears to display incorrectly if it's unknown on MusicBrainz. (2548)
    • Fixed problem with removing albums/files after submitting PUIDs (2556)
    • The user's script should be applied also to album metadata.
    • Fixed moving of additional files from paths with "special" characters.
  • Internals:
    • The browser integration HTTP server rewritten using QTcpServer.

Version 0.9.0alpha5 - 2007-03-18

  • New Features:
    • Replace Æ with AE in file/directory names. (2512)
    • "Add cluster as release" (1049)
    • Text labels under icon buttons. (2476)
  • Bug Fixes:
    • Fixed fileId generator (caused problems with drag&drop if files with multiple formats are used).
    • Original Metadata not greyed out when no tracks are attached. (2461)
    • Better detecting of the default Windows browser, with fallback to Internet Explorer. (2502)
    • Better album/track lookup. (2521)
    • File browser stays 'hidden' after first time use. (2480)
    • Track length changed in Original Metadata after save. (2510)
    • "Send PUIDs" button not disabled after albums are removed. (2506)
    • The Windows package now includes JPEG loader to show cover art images correctly. (2478)

Version 0.9.0alpha4 - 2007-03-09

  • Bug Fixes:
    • Fixed case-insentive file renaming. (2457, 2513)

Version 0.9.0alpha3 - 2007-03-08

  • New Features:
    • Using of 'performed by' AR types (without instrument or vocal).
    • The "Replace non-ASCII characters" option will try to remove accents first. (2466)
    • Added option to auto-analyze all files. (2465)
  • Bug Fixes:
    • Fixed file clustering.
    • Added %albumartistsort%, %releasetype% and %releasestatus% to the file naming example (2458)
    • Sanitize dates from ID3 tags. (2460)
    • Fixed page switching in the options window on error. (2455)
    • Correct case-insensitive file renaming on Windows (1003, 2457)
    • Relative paths in the 'Move files to' option are relative to the current path of the file. (2454)
    • Added a .desktop file. (2470)
    • Release type and status should be in lower case. (2489)

Version 0.9.0alpha2 - 2007-03-04

  • New Features:
    • New variable %_extension% (2447)
    • File naming format tester. (2448)
    • Added automatic checking for new versions.
  • Bug Fixes:
    • Fixed window position saving/restoring. (2449)
    • Fixed iTunes compilation flag saving. (2450)

Version 0.9.0alpha1 - 2007-03-03

  • First release.
